### What is Tapioca Pudding?
Tapioca pudding is a traditional dessert made from **tapioca pearls**, which are small, translucent beads derived from the cassava root. When cooked, these pearls take on a soft, chewy texture that pairs perfectly with the smooth, creamy base of the pudding. The pudding itself is typically made with milk, sugar, and eggs, creating a rich custard-like consistency.
Though often flavored with vanilla, tapioca pudding can be customized with your favorite ingredients. Some people enjoy adding fruit, cinnamon, or even a hint of coconut for a tropical twist. ### Ingredients for Homemade Tapioca Pudding:
Here’s what you’ll need to make a classic, creamy tapioca pudding:
– 1/2 cup small tapioca pearls
– 3 cups whole milk (you can substitute with coconut milk for a dairy-free version)
– 2/3 cup granulated sugar
– 1/4 teaspoon salt
– 2 large eggs
– 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
– 1 tablespoon butter (optional, for added creaminess)
